From 8c9dee18b3c1f4dbadc57d2059f6b0a61e417ec9 Mon Sep 17 00:00:00 2001 From: Rahul Deshmukh Date: Fri, 19 Mar 2010 14:35:29 +0530 Subject: [PATCH] b=21957 debug_mb not correctly initialized on newer kernels (2.6.31) i=adilger i=rread Fixed the debug_mb initialization problem for kernel 2.6.31 --- lnet/libcfs/debug.c | 6 +++--- 1 file changed, 3 insertions(+), 3 deletions(-) diff --git a/lnet/libcfs/debug.c b/lnet/libcfs/debug.c index 3707c9a..ba2369a 100644 --- a/lnet/libcfs/debug.c +++ b/lnet/libcfs/debug.c @@ -63,8 +63,8 @@ CFS_MODULE_PARM(libcfs_debug, "i", int, 0644, "Lustre kernel debug mask"); EXPORT_SYMBOL(libcfs_debug); -int libcfs_debug_mb = -1; -CFS_MODULE_PARM(libcfs_debug_mb, "i", int, 0644, +unsigned int libcfs_debug_mb = 0; +CFS_MODULE_PARM(libcfs_debug_mb, "i", uint, 0644, "Total debug buffer size."); EXPORT_SYMBOL(libcfs_debug_mb); @@ -485,7 +485,7 @@ void libcfs_debug_dumplog(void) int libcfs_debug_init(unsigned long bufsize) { int rc = 0; - int max = libcfs_debug_mb; + unsigned int max = libcfs_debug_mb; cfs_waitq_init(&debug_ctlwq); -- 1.8.3.1